Every year they get rated in a different order. I personally have been using AVG for years, as they more consistently rank toward the top, but the reviews seem to think that it's not that user friendly, so some ppl might have some trouble using some of the features.
As far as you malware problem, I find malwarebytes to work the best, however some viruses prevent you from installing. If that happens, try booting into safe mode
with networking (you have to press f8 right
before the windows loading screen comes up) and try running ur AV and malwarebytes.
Other Malware scans you can try:
Spybot
Ad-aware
Superantispyware.
If that doesn't work, your options are remove the drive, and scan as an external drive (which runs the risk of infecting the host), or reformatting.
